Mechanical assistance in the surgical treatment of massive abdominal pannus

Abstract

A 32 year-old male patient was effectively immobilized secondary to morbid obesity. He underwent a gastric bypass which reduced his weight from 647 lbs to 376 lbs over 12 months. A massive abdominal panniculus persisted limiting his ability to pursue an effective exercise program and maintain appropriate hygiene. The patient was operated upon with the aid of Steinman pins to pierce the dependant portion of the pannus and an orthopaedic suspension device to facilitate its elevation. Operative excision of the 19.93 kg pannus proceeded in a rapid fashion with minimal difficulties in pannus manipulation. The technique of excision, its benefits and the case history are reviewed.
